Position Overview:
- Mission Trainer Team Lead to support intelligence training operations at Fort Belvoir, VA. This position serves as the senior authority responsible for leading the development, delivery, and oversight of intelligence training programs aligned with mission objectives, tradecraft standards, and evolving operational requirements.
- The Mission Trainer Team Lead will provide strategic direction, instructional leadership, and curriculum oversight while ensuring all training products comply with S. Army TRADOC standards, applicable doctrine, and Intelligence Community (IC) requirements. This role requires a subject matter expert with extensive experience in intelligence operations, training development, and leadership of distributed training teams.
Key Responsibilities:
Leadership & Program Oversight
- Serve as the team lead for mission training personnel, providing leadership, guidance, and performance oversight.
- Coordinate training activities across multiple locations to ensure standardization and mission alignment.
- Interface directly with Government stakeholders to align training objectives with operational priorities.
- Provide strategic input into training program development, modernization, and continuous improvement initiatives.
Training Development & Curriculum Management
- Lead the design, development, and validation of training materials and curricula in accordance with TRADOC and Army standards.
- Oversee creation and maintenance of lesson plans, instructional materials, presentations, and courseware.
- Ensure integration of intelligence tradecraft, doctrine updates, and emerging operational requirements into training products.
- Manage training content within Government systems such as AGILE, Training Development Capability (TDC), or equivalent platforms.
Instruction & Training Delivery
- Deliver and supervise instructor-led training for military and intelligence audiences.
- Ensure consistency and quality of training delivery across geographically dispersed training environments.
- Conduct and oversee training sessions across multiple U.S. locations.
Doctrine & Policy Integration
- Review and analyze emerging policies, doctrine, and intelligence guidance for incorporation into training materials.
- Provide recommendations to Government leadership on training updates based on evolving threats, mission needs, and doctrinal changes.
Training Operations & Compliance
- Develop and maintain training records, metrics, and reporting mechanisms as required by the Government.
- Ensure compliance with all applicable DoD, Army, and IC training standards.
- Support audits, inspections, and evaluations of training programs and materials.
Required Qualifications:
- Minimum 10 years of experience in an intelligence discipline within DoD or the Intelligence Community (within the last 15 years)
- Minimum 5 years of experience developing training materials and curriculum in accordance with TRADOC and Army standards
- Minimum 5 years of experience conducting training across multiple U.S. geographic locations
- Demonstrated experience instructing military audiences and delivering intelligence-related training
- Proven experience leading teams and managing training programs or initiatives
Education Requirements:
- Bachelor's Degree in Intelligence, National Security, Military Science, or related field AND 10 Years of relevant Experience
OR
- Associate's Degree AND 12 Years of relevant Experience.
Clearance Requirements:
- Active DoD TS/SCI Clearance Required
- CI Polygraph Eligibility
